1. Understand the Role of a Mortgage Broker

A mortgage broker acts as your financial matchmaker, bridging the gap between you and potential lenders. They’ll assess your financial situation, creditworthiness and homeownership goals to find a mortgage product that suits your needs. Importantly, they can help secure favourable terms and competitive interest rates that you might not be able to access independently.

5. Check Credentials

Verify that the mortgage broker you’re considering is licensed and accredited. In Australia, mortgage brokers are typically regulated by the Australian Securities and Investments Commission (ASIC).

Tip: Engage only with a licensed broker because they are obligated to follow ethical and professional standards, offering you an extra layer of protection.

8. Understand Fee Structure

Ask about the broker’s fee structure upfront. Keep in mind that some brokers are remunerated by lenders, while others charge borrowers directly. Find out how the broker will be compensated and whether there could be any conflicts of interest.

Tip: Remember that transparency in fees is essential. You should have a clear understanding of the costs associated with the broker’s services.

9. Compare Rates and Offers

Request quotes and mortgage comparisons from multiple brokers. Compare the interest rates, loan terms, and any additional fees associated with each product.

Tip: Take note of the comparison rates, rather than the interest rates. Sometimes, a seemingly higher interest rate can lead to lower overall costs due to fewer fees.

12. Review the Broker’s Panel of Lenders

Mortgage brokers often work with a large panel of lenders. Confirm that the broker’s network encompasses a broad spectrum of lenders, as this ensures you have access to diverse home loan options.

Tip: Prioritise diversified lender options, especially if you have unique financial circumstances.
